Since it's a gift from your Dad ... go with the OMEGA Speedmaster so you won't break the bank (his bank). It's what my Mom gave me when I commissioned .... :) it survived the TRACOM, SERE, JEST, C-WEST, Mombasa, the PO, a hundred gin joints in 100 liberty ports, 3000 hours of A-4/A-6 time and one ejection. I had it rebuilt a couple of years ago and it still keeps perfect time and looks like new.

When YOU have established yourself ... get a *ahem* ROLEX. It shows you have "arrived" ... and you did it yourself.
